Ronnie Davies felt Chris Eubank Junior’s slow start cost him the chance of title glory against big fight rival Billy Joe Saunders.

Brighton middleweight Eubank Jr, 25, lost on a split decision to British, European and Commonwealth champion Saunders at the ExCel London despite a stirring late charge.

Former two-weight world champion Chris Eubank senior and trainer Davies worked Junior’s corner for the 12-round WBO world middleweight eliminator.

Saunders had the better of the early rounds on most people’s cards and Davies felt that was pivotal.

Davies, 68, said: “I was disappointed with the way he fought.

“I told him to get the early rounds in the bank against Saunders and was disappointed that he gave the first rounds away.

“I said before the fight that he can’t afford to give the early rounds away because then you have to win two fights - the first to wipe out the lead and then a second to take the fight.”
